Is Gamera friendly?

This fifteen-year period saw eight total Gamera films released, with the first seven being released in subsequent years, from 1965 to 1971. The Shōwa films are light-heartened and kid-friendly, with children heavily factoring into many of the stories, providing Gamera with a reason to save the day.

Is Gamera a bad guy?

Type of Villain Gamera is the main protagonist of the franchise of the same name, appearing as the main antagonist of the first film and the main protagonist of the other films. He is a large tortoise kaiju who started out as an antagonist but was later redeemed as a protector of humanity.

Will Godzilla ever fight Gamera?

Well, yes. And no. Awesome Monster Battle Godzilla vs. Gamera was a one-act stage show co-created by Toho and Daiei — which is quite frankly astonishing — that took place in March of 1970 during the Children Festival at the Osaka World’s Fair.

How did the character Gamera get his name?

Gamera has been described as being a rip-off of Godzilla. The name Gamera (ガメラ) derives from the Japanese kame (“turtle”), and the suffix -ra, a suffix shared by such other kaiju characters as Godzilla ( Gojira) and Mothra.
